- I have a little Dairy Bull,
Both frolicsome and frisky,
He broke all fences with his skull
And trespassed on ComiskeyThen rambled round and saw strange cows,
Which made him mighty jealous.
So just to start some friendly rows
He trespassed on Dick Ellis. While there he started swanking round
To show he was a bad "un".
He leaped the river in a bound
Right into Tullybradden.His pedigree is very good,
His dam is "Bradshaw's Fancy".
His sire has Double Dairy blood
Like his half-sister Nancy.He's registered and tattooed well,
And licensed by the Dáil.
But when he's taken out to sell
He's not looked at, at all.(continues on next page)- Collector
